DEA Prescription Drug Take Back Day Is Saturday

SOUTHERN ILLINOIS – The Drug Enforcement Administration’s 25th Prescription Drug Take Back Day happens Saturday.

This event lets you get rid of potentially dangerous prescription medications like tablets, capsules, patches and other solid forms of prescription drugs. Liquids (including intravenous solutions), syringes, and other sharps and illegal drugs will not be accepted.

DEA will continue to accept vaping devices and cartridges at its drop-off locations provided lithium batteries are removed. 

Police departments and sheriff’s offices across our area will be participating in this event from 10 a.m. to 2 p.m. To find one near you, go to dea.gov/takebackday.
